DTC P2178 (L3) DETECTION CONDITION & POSSIBLE CAUSES
| DTC P2178 |
Fuel system too rich at off idle |
| DETECTION CONDITION |
- PCM monitors short term fuel trim (SHRTFT) and long term fuel trim (LONGFT) during closed loop fuel control at off-idle. If the LONGFT and the sum total of these fuel trims or SHRTFT exceed pre programmed criteria. PCM determines that fuel system is too rich at off-idle.
Diagnostic support note
- This is a continuous monitor. (Fuel system)
- MIL illuminates if the PCM detects the above malfunction condition in two consecutive drive cycles or in one drive cycle while the DTC for the same malfunction has been stored in the PCM.
- PENDING CODE is available if the PCM detects the above malfunction condition during the first drive cycle.
- FREEZE FRAME DATA is available.
- DTC is stored in the PCM memory.

| POSSIBLE CAUSE |
- Erratic signal to PCM
- ECT sensor
- MAF sensor
- TP sensor
- Related connector or terminal malfunction
- Related wiring harness malfunction
- Leakage exhaust system
- A/F sensor deterioration
- A/F sensor heater malfunction
- MAF sensor malfunction
- Air suction in intake air system
- Purge solenoid valve improper operation
- Purge solenoid valve malfunction (stuck open)
- Purge solenoid hoses improper connection
- EGR valve improper operation
- VTCS improper operation
- Variable valve timing control system improper operation
- Pressure regulator (built-in fuel injection pump) malfunction
- Fuel pump malfunction
- PCV valve malfunction
- Misfire
- PCM malfunction
